I went to New York for the final few days at the end of the egg hunt but Simon had gone out before to make sure our eggs arrive safely and placed on their plinths in their secret locations…



Just having a quick spruce up!

The eggs were all hidden in locations around New York until the final week of the Egg Hunt when the eggs were located all around the Rockafeller Centre for everyone to see!


An app was created by Saatchi & Saatchi New York and each egg had its own chip where the hunter could scan the egg and digitally collect them - the person who collect all the eggs could be entered into a draw to win a Faberge Egg Pendant!






The Alphaegg of New York was hidden in the window of The Scholastic Children's Bookstore...



Where they also sold my 'Eggsclusive' Alphaegg Tote bag!






In the last week of the egg hunt all of the eggs were located at the Rockerfeller Centre…The Alphaegg was placed next to Tracey Emin's Egg…
